Henry Betheny, Austin County, Texas, 1867
Henry Betheny registered to vote in Austin County on July 25, 1867. He reported Alabama as his birthplace and 19 years in Texas, 19 of them in Austin County. The registrar wrote "Colored" beside his name. Austin County registered 1,107 freedmen in 1867, 43% of its voters.

This entry comes from the 1867 to 1870 Texas voter registration, the Texas Secretary of State registration lists held by the Texas State Library and Archives Commission. It sits on page 8 of the Austin County volume, written out by hand. About Enslaved Texas.
